    Discover the Charm of Dustin, Oklahoma: A Hidden Gem in the Sooner State

    Dustin, Oklahoma, is a delightful blend of warm community spirit and natural beauty that creates a truly inviting atmosphere for residents and visitors alike. Located in Hughes County, this small town offers a refreshing escape from the hustle and bustle, where the pace of life is as gentle as the Oklahoma sky. Despite its modest size, Dustin boasts a strong sense of community, where neighbors know each other by name and greet each other with a friendly wave. The town's local events and gatherings, such as the annual county fair and seasonal festivals, are perfect opportunities for new residents to feel right at home. Family-friendly and safe, Dustin offers an environment where children can enjoy their childhoods in the great outdoors without a worry. Nature enthusiasts will find themselves enchanted by the scenic landscapes surrounding Dustin. Explore the nearby tranquil lakes and rolling countryside, ideal for fishing, hiking, or simply savoring an Oklahoma sunset. The area's natural beauty offers not just recreation, but a peaceful retreat for those seeking solace in the countryside’s embrace. In Dustin, Oklahoma, the heart of the community is felt in every corner, making it a place where people of all ages can thrive. This small-town charm provides the perfect backdrop for building lifelong memories and connections.
